Clarkson suffered a patellar tendon strain in his left knee during the third quarter and won't return to Wednesday's contest against the Nuggets, Chris Dempsey of the Denver Post reports.

Analysis:

It's unclear how serious Clarkson's injury might be, and a full update likely won't be known until Thursday. He finished with 13 points (4-13 FG, 3-8 3Pt, 2-2 FT), three rebounds, and one steal over 23 minutes before his departure. The Lakers next play Friday against the Hawks, and he should be considered questionable at best for that game until we hear more.
